HINTS AND TIPS
Most wae batter can be poured directly onto the nonstick wae plate • (5).
Use a cooking spray for dessert waes or any recipe with a lot of sugar. If your
waes start to stick, the wae plates (3, 5) may need to be scrubbed with a
nylon brush to remove any cooked-on food particles.
Most waes can be made ahead of time and kept warm in a 200°F (90°C) oven. •
To store waes, let them cool and then pack into an airtight container. Store in •
a refrigerator or freezer. Waes can be reheated in a microwave oven or regular
oven.
Most waes are done in about• 3 to 6 minutes. Recipes made from scratch may
take longer. Check for doneness after approximately 5 minutes or when the
steaming stops. If the appliance does not open easily, allow waes to cook for
another minute before checking again.
CLEANING
Proper maintenance will ensure many years of service from your appliance. Clean
the appliance after every use. The appliance contains no user serviceable parts and
requires little maintenance. Leave any servicing or repairs to qualied personnel.
CAUTION: Always turn the temperature control knob (10) to position 0. Disconnect
the plug (8) from the wall outlet (ill.
j
). Allow all parts of the appliance to cool
down completely.
NOTE: Do not immerse the power cord and plug (8) or appliance into water or any
other liquid. Do not use abrasive cleaners, steel wool or scouring pads (ill.
l
). Dry
all parts thoroughly after cleaning, before using or storing the appliance. Ensure
that no water enters the appliance housing.
Clean the housing of the appliance and wae plates • (3, 5) with a damp, soapy
cloth.
Rinse cloth and wipe all parts again. •
Clean the measuring cup • (6) under running water or in a dishwasher.
Dry the appliance and any accessories thoroughly.•
RECIPES
Basic wae recipe (for 4 ½ cups of batter, 1.125L)
2 cups (500ml) our
2 tablespoons (30ml) sugar
1 tablespoon (15ml) baking powder
1 teaspoon (5ml) salt
1 ¾ cups (425ml) milk
1/3 cup (85ml) vegetable oil
2 eggs
Combine our, sugar, baking powder and salt. Whisk together milk, oil and •
eggs.
Gradually add milk mixture to the dry ingredients. •
Stir until batter is even and smooth. Pour batter onto wae plate. •
Basic Blueberry Waes:
After pouring batter onto wae plate (5), sprinkle fresh blueberries over batter,
then close the appliance.
